虚拟机与物理机性能对比研究方法,虚拟机与物理机性能对比研究,理论与实践分析
- 综合资讯
- 2024-11-20 12:13:35
- 0
本文研究虚拟机与物理机的性能对比,采用理论与实践相结合的方法,对比分析两者在性能上的差异。通过实验验证,提出优化虚拟机性能的建议,为虚拟化技术在实际应用中提供参考。...
本文研究虚拟机与物理机的性能对比,采用理论与实践相结合的方法,对比分析两者在性能上的差异。通过实验验证,提出优化虚拟机性能的建议,为虚拟化技术在实际应用中提供参考。
随着信息技术的飞速发展,虚拟化技术已成为现代计算机系统的重要组成部分,虚拟机(Virtual Machine,VM)与物理机(Physical Machine,PM)作为两种常见的计算资源,各自具有不同的性能特点,为了更好地了解和利用这两种资源,本文通过对虚拟机与物理机性能的对比研究,分析其优缺点,为实际应用提供理论依据。
研究方法
1、理论研究
本文从虚拟化技术原理、虚拟机与物理机架构、性能评价指标等方面进行理论研究,为后续实验提供理论支持。
2、实验研究
(1)实验环境
本文采用VMware Workstation作为虚拟机软件,Intel Xeon E5-2680 v3处理器、32GB内存、1TB硬盘作为物理机硬件平台,虚拟机操作系统为Windows 10,物理机操作系统为Windows Server 2012 R2。
(2)实验方法
①性能评价指标
本文选取CPU利用率、内存利用率、磁盘I/O速度、网络传输速率等指标作为性能评价指标。
②实验方案
a. 虚拟机性能测试
对虚拟机进行CPU、内存、磁盘I/O、网络等方面的性能测试,记录实验数据。
b. 物理机性能测试
对物理机进行CPU、内存、磁盘I/O、网络等方面的性能测试,记录实验数据。
c. 对比分析
将虚拟机与物理机的实验数据进行分析对比,得出结论。
实验结果与分析
1、CPU利用率
实验结果表明,在同等硬件配置下,虚拟机的CPU利用率低于物理机,原因在于虚拟化技术需要在宿主机上运行虚拟机管理程序,导致部分CPU资源被占用。
2、内存利用率
虚拟机的内存利用率高于物理机,这是因为虚拟机可以共享宿主机的内存资源,而物理机则需独立分配内存。
3、磁盘I/O速度
虚拟机的磁盘I/O速度低于物理机,原因在于虚拟机需要进行磁盘I/O请求转发,增加了请求处理时间。
4、网络传输速率
虚拟机的网络传输速率低于物理机,原因在于虚拟化技术对网络请求进行了封装和解封装,增加了传输延迟。
1、虚拟机与物理机在CPU利用率、磁盘I/O速度、网络传输速率等方面存在差异,虚拟机性能略低于物理机。
2、虚拟机在内存利用率方面具有优势,可以更好地利用宿主机资源。
3、在实际应用中,应根据具体需求选择合适的计算资源,对于对性能要求较高的应用,物理机更具优势;对于对资源利用率要求较高的应用,虚拟机更具优势。
展望
随着虚拟化技术的不断发展,虚拟机性能将逐步提升,未来研究方向包括:
1、优化虚拟化技术,提高虚拟机性能。
2、研究新型虚拟化架构,降低虚拟机对宿主机资源的占用。
3、开发针对特定应用的虚拟化优化方案。
虚拟机与物理机在性能方面存在差异,但各有优势,通过对两者性能的对比研究,有助于更好地了解和利用这两种计算资源,为实际应用提供理论依据。
本文链接:https://www.zhitaoyun.cn/974852.html
发表评论